Abstract

An endoscopic tissue apposition device that includes a vacuum chamber configured to securely hold a portion of tissue therein, the vacuum chamber being defined by a proximal wall and a distal wall opposite to the proximal wall. Working and vacuum channels are provided in communication with the vacuum chamber. A portion of tissue is held in the vacuum chamber when vacuum is applied in the vacuum chamber through the vacuum channel. A carrier needle is disposed on a proximal side of the vacuum chamber and is longitudinally advanceable into and across the vacuum chamber, while a punch needle is disposed on a distal side of the vacuum chamber and is configured to receive the carrier needle therein. A hold and release mechanism holds and releases the punch needle to facilitate joining portions of tissue together.
